What can I see and do near Philadelphia's Magic Gardens?
You'll want to browse the collections at Museum of the American Revolution, African American Museum in Philadelphia, and Mummers Museum. Some landmarks that you won't want to miss include Theater of Living Arts, Independence Hall, and Free Library of Philadelphia. You can check out the local talent at Kimmel Center for the Performing Arts, Walnut Street Theatre, and Miller Theater.
